I made these today from 3/4" Cocobola about 9" long. I turned the blade to a taper, trimmed on a Bandsaw and finished up with a belt sander and some hand sanding. I Beall buffed and put on some Reanaissance wax.

With all of the horror stories I have heard about Cocobola causing severe reactions, turning it tends to make me a little cautious. I wear a nuisance dusk mask and keep the DC going. And wash my hands afterwards. Hope that is enough.
